Output 81f1a25cecfb08b6f7af1c204ecd664e6c7eae3683fd8ae83a224ac20fbca8aa:25

value
250521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ae178d5fcef6d5ea19fd66e9a2ae445635e1c96f OP_EQUAL
address
3HZXiMsxKU4coHi4jUFkFnVxDpMqmSxhWu
transaction
81f1a25cecfb08b6f7af1c204ecd664e6c7eae3683fd8ae83a224ac20fbca8aa
spent
true